郭威廷 (Kuo Wei-Ting)   

I'm a self-taught learner with a passion for new technologies. Skilled in Python and Golang, and can independently develop web applications. Familiar with back-end development using Golang/Gin and have experience with Vue3 for front-end development. 

I'm seeking a back-end engineering job or internship opportunity to enhance my skills and contribute to company growth.

  Taipei City, Taiwan

   Email:  [email protected]       Phone: 0979395396  


Skills

Programming Language

  • Golang / Gin 
  • Python3 / Numpy, Pandas, Scipy 

Web

  • HTML / CSS 
  • JavaScript / Vue3, Element Plus 

Database

  • Postgres 
  • Redis 

Others

  • RESTful, gRPC
  • JWT, Session
  • Git
  • Docker

Experience

Attach to read with the class  •  National Taipei University of Technology

September 2022 - Now

  • Achieved high marks (GPA: 4.0/4.0) in three courses taken during the fall 2022 semester: 
    Data Structure, Computer Networking, and Discrete Mathematics.
  • Currently taking three courses in the ongoing semester: 
    Algorithm, Computer Organization, and Operating Systems.

Research assistant  •  National Taiwan University (Rock Mechanics Lab.)

August 2022 - December 2022

  • Analyzed hydraulic conductivity of rock mass based on statistical analysis of geometric data of rock fractures using Python and Matlab.
  • Developed the analysis model using Python/Scipy and automated the analysis process.
  • Visualized data analysis results using Python/Matplotlib.
  • Overcame research obstacles and completed the project, and completion of an academic journal draft.

Project

Full-stack blog project  

A full-stack blog management system and front-end display platform based on Gin + Vue3, aiming to provide a blog platform that is easy to manage articles. 

  • The server is based on Golang framework Gin and uses the RESTful api.
  • Postgres based database and reflects data models using Gorm.
  • JWT token-based authorization for user login interface
  • Support front-end display of Markdown-based articles
  • Support blog management system to manage the content, type, tags and comments of articles.


Full-stack e-commerce

A full-stack e-commerce system based on Gin and Vue3, providing a platform for online shopping.

  • Golang/Gin based server, using clean code to create RESTful APIs.

  • Test-driven development (TDD) is followed during the development process to ensure high-quality code.

  • Maintain the SQL queries by using sqlc to ensure the efficiency of the Postgres database.

  • The APIs are secured with JWT technology, requiring authorization for access.

Education

National Taiwan University

Civil engineering

2020 - 2022

National Chiao Tung University

Civil engineering

2016 - 2020

Language

   Chinese — native   

    English — advance      TOEIC: 835

School Clubs

2018 - 2019

Vice Director  NCTU Civil Engineering Student Association

  • Organized various departmental events as the Vice Director
  • Fostered close relationships with seniors and juniors during my tenure.

May 2018 - Oct. 2018

Event General Coordinator  NCTU Civil Engineering Union Orientation

  • Coordinated a joint orientation event for approximately 100 students from two departments.
  • Responsible for organizing the event schedule, managing manpower allocation and coordination with various vendors.